'Israeli'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u welcomed Argentine President Javier Milei in Jerusalem during an official visit aimed at strengthening bilateral relations.

The two leaders greeted each other warmly, with Netanyahu noting the similarity between “Javier” and the Hebrew word “chaver,” meaning friend. 

Both sides announced the launch of the “Isaac Accords,” an initiative aimed at expanding cooperation between 'Israel' and Argentina.

The visit will also include the signing of agreements covering aviation, security, and artificial intelligence, alongside plans to open a direct flight route between the two countries.

Their meeting came after the Argentine President visited Jerusalem's Western Wall.

Milei is also scheduled to take part in 'Israel’s' annual "Independence Day" ceremony, where he is expected to light a ceremonial torch.
